Note to self.... if i am ever under house arrest for foreign dealings, don’t call people over seas and ask them to testify for me. Let my lawyer do that.

I'm mostly a civil litigator these days, but back when I did white-collar criminal defense, the first piece of advice given to any client was not to talk to anyone about the case. If you want to find out what a witness is going to say, the defendant's lawyer asks the witness's lawyer. Direct communication between a defendant and a witness is asking for trouble.
